China Securities: Fluorine-based New Materials Poised for High Growth Driven by Semiconductors and AI

CN1 hr ago

Everbright Securities (光大证券) has released a research report indicating that leading Chinese fluorine chemical companies are accelerating their expansion into fluorine-based new materials, aiming to establish a second growth trajectory. This strategic move is significantly propelled by advancements in the semiconductor industry and the burgeoning AI sector. In the semiconductor domain, high-purity electronic-grade hydrofluoric acid, crucial for chip manufacturing, was historically dominated by Japanese and American firms. However, domestic Chinese enterprises have recently overcome technological hurdles in ultra-pure processing, leveraging their integrated industrial chains. Consequently, electronic-grade hydrofluoric acid has successfully passed stringent certifications from major domestic and international foundries and is now entering a phase of scaled production. Simultaneously, the rapid growth in computing power for AI, High-Performance Computing (HPC), and hyperscale data centers is increasing heat density, rendering traditional air-cooling methods insufficient for high-power scenarios. Liquid cooling is emerging as the essential solution for efficient heat dissipation. Fluorine chemical companies are responding to this trend by actively developing high-performance fluorinated coolants, such as perfluoropolyethers (PFPE). These materials offer superior insulation, non-flammability, and excellent thermal management properties, making them indispensable for high-safety, high-power applications like immersion liquid cooling. The development of these advanced fluorine-based materials is guiding fluorine chemical enterprises towards a deeper transformation into high-technology, high-value-added sectors.
